Unknown item in W&B
I'm looking through my old W&B docs, and I found this line item in the original factory W&B:
"MODEL 337TURBO SUPER SKYMASTR" [sic] Weight: 159.0 lbs Arm: 115.5 The airframe itself is listed as "STANDARD AIRPLANE (EMPTY,DRY,UNPAINTED) ACTUAL" with a weight of 2617.5 and an arm of 141.6. Does anyone know what that 159 lb item is? Is that the factory way of listing the turbo system? I find it odd that they'd build it, weigh it, and *then* add turbos. At some point my c.g. jumped over an inch and a half forward and I'm trying to find out when & why. It's currently 137.5, which seems VERY far forward. I go out of c.g. with two people and 1/2 fuel. It's been as far forward as 137.2, which seems to me to be dangerously far forward. It came from the factory at 138.9. The w&b that moved it from 138.9 to 137.2 is missing.
